Overview and admission
Study Type
undergraduate
Admission semester
Summer and Winter Semester
Area of study
Mechanical Engineering
Focus
Decentral and Regenerative Energy Plants, Electromobility, Thermotechnical Units, Processing Machines and Extraction and Special Mining Machines, Gas Engineering, Design Engineering, Calculation and Simulation, Thermal Fluid Dynamics, Process Automation
Admission requirements
School leaving certificate or subject-restricted higher education entrance qualification or other eligibility for admission recognised as equivalent
